Which statement describes the VSEPR theory?

a- Electron pairs in the valence shell of an atom have a tendency to attract other nearby electron pairs.

b- Electrons in the valence shell of an atom exert a repulsive force on other atoms while forming a chemical bond.

c- Electron pairs in the valence shell of an atom exert a repulsive force on all other electron pairs in the valence shell of the atom.

d- Electrons in the valence shell exert a repulsive force while completing their octet during the formation of chemical bond.

I believe the correct answer from the choices listed above is option C. The statement that describes the VSEPR theory would that electron pairs in the valence shell of an atom exert a repulsive force on all other electron pairs in the valence shell of the atom.
